                                                                                               Do you have a window that’s rarely accessed, but
                                  Tips for the
                                  Busy Balebusta
                                                                                               it blasts freezing air through your apartment?
                                                                                               If you don’t mind the aesthetic, you can easily and
                                                                                               effectively  insulate  it  using  bubble  wrap.  You’ll
                                                                                               need a roll of bubble wrap that has medium or
                                                    WEATHER
                                                                                               large bubbles – they’re pretty cheap at Walmart
                                                                                               or similar stores.
                                                                                               Spray  the  window  with  water,  then  press  the
                                                                                               bubble  wrap  onto  the  wet  window  with  the
                                                                                               bubbles facing the window. If it fails to stick, spray a bit more water and try again.
                                                                                               Done correctly, it should last all winter and can be easily removed by peeling it off.
                DRAFT DETECTION
                Bedikas Chametz is one time we walk around the house with a candle; the other time
                is when we try to locate a draft. If you feel the cold coming in from somewhere but
                can’t find its origin, the flicker of a candle will help guide you. Carry it slowly around
                the cold room and watch the flame for any signs of wind blowing through, so you   SLIPPERY SHOVEL
                know where you need to winterproof.
